What Does Final Expense Insurance Cover?
As you might have guessed from your name, your funeral expenses are covered by burial insurance. Including obvious things like buying your final resting place, purchasing the coffin (or cremation costs), paying for your own funeral service, and purchasing a headstone.
Other lesser known costs that can often be covered are things like grave digging and floral arrangements. They’re able to accumulate quickly, although they are not large on their own.
For an unprepared family who may not have a lot of disposable income, these costs (which can run into the thousands of dollars) can be a significant jolt. How Much Burial Insurance Insurance Cost?

Prices for interment insurance plans differ radically between providers. Some basic coverage strategies can start from just a couple dollars weekly, however there are highly comprehensive strategies that cost more.
The policies normally provide coverage between $5000 and $25,000 but on occasion, you can find policies that provide coverage up to $50k Better coverage demands higher fees, nevertheless as you could imagine.
Most payments are made monthly, but there are several plans that take weekly payments too.
The sum you should pay is primarily determined by your actual age. The old you’re, the more your premiums will be. If you’re mathematically closer to passing, you’re likely to should cover more over a shorter level of time it’s simple economics actually. On account of their lifespans that are mathematically shorter, men have a tendency to pay more for final expense insurance than women.
